      • Algorithmic Approach for Safe Optimization and Surgical Planning in Hilar Blocks- Single Center Experience

        ( Rohan Jagat Chaudhary ),( V. Sagar Puppala ),( Thiagarajan S. ),( Prashant Bhangui ),( Amit Rastogi ),( Tarun Piplani ),( S. Baijal ),( V. Vohra ),( Arvinder Singh Soin ) 대한간학회 2020 춘·추계 학술대회 (KASL) Vol.2020 No.1

        Aims: To study the outcomes of our algorithmic-approach for safe optimisation and surgical planning in patients with Hilar- Block. Methods: Retrospective-analysis of prospectively-maintained database of patients undergoing surgery for hilar-block from Jan2013-May2019 was done.Our approach includes Imaging, Biliary-decompression, Future-liver-remnant-Volume(FLR)augmentation based on CT-Volumetry and FLR-function assessment. Results: 45cases of hilar-blocks underwent resections.32were Hilar-cholangiocarcinoma,5-Intrahepatic-cholangiocarcinoma, 6-Ca-Gall-Bladder with hilar-block,2-IgG4-sclerosing- cholangitis-presenting as malignant-masquerade. The mean age was57±12years and 30(67%) were males. On MRCP, hilar-blocks types 2,3a,3b,4 were 3,15,17,10 respectively. Pre-operative biliary-decompression of FLR were done in 21cases[19 PTBD(Percutaneous-Transhepatic-biliary-drainage)/ 2 EBD(Endoscopic-biliary-drainage)]. Additional PTBD were done in 2 cases for inadequate fall in SB, and 3 for cholangitis. The mean SB(Serum-Total-Bilirubin) at presentation was 9.57±5.58mg/dl. The rate of fall of S.bilirubin was faster in patients < 50yrs of age and type-3 hilar-blocks than in type-4 hilar- blocks. PVE was performed in 14cases and FLR hypertrophy of 11.3± 3.03%was achieved.The quality of FLR was assessed with LAI(n=39),fibroscan(n=17), ICGR15(n=12), HVPG (n=35), and selective-remnant-biopsy(n=14,if HVPG >10 mm Hg,ICGR15> 15%, or in-suspected steatosis or fibrosis).After optimization, surgical procedures done were Right-Hepatectomy(7), Right-TriSectorectomy(7), Extended-Right-Hepatectomy(9), Left-Hepatectomy(6),Extended-Left-Hepatectomy(5), Left-Trisectorectomy( 8) and Bile-duct-excision-alone(3).Eleven patients required concomitant vascular-resections and reconstructions(- 8portal-vein-resections, 2 hepatic-arterial-resection,1both) to obtain R0. R0 and R1 resections were achieved in 42(93%) and 3 patients. Clavien-Dindo-Grade3/4 complications were 22.2%(n=10). 8(18%)patients had Post-Hepatectomy-Liver- Failure.Overall operative-mortality was 5/45(11.1%). Conclusions: Our algorithmic approach for safe optimization by preoperative-biliary-drainage, FLR-augmentation and FLR-functional- assessment have led to a high rate of R0 major liver resection and good outcomes in patients with hilar-blocks.Augmentation of FLR can also increase resectability in borderline resectable cases.

        Numerical analysis of geocell reinforced ballast overlying soft clay subgrade

        Saride, Sireesh,Pradhan, Sailesh,Sitharam, T.G.,Puppala, Anand J. Techno-Press 2013 Geomechanics & engineering Vol.5 No.3

        Geotextiles and geogrids have been in use for several decades in variety of geo-structure applications including foundation of embankments, retaining walls, pavements. Geocells is one such variant in geosynthetic reinforcement of recent years, which provides a three dimensional confinement to the infill material. Although extensive research has been carried on geocell reinforced sand, clay and layered soil subgrades, limited research has been reported on the aggregates/ballast reinforced with geocells. This paper presents the behavior of a railway sleeper subjected to monotonic loading on geocell reinforced aggregates, of size ranging from 20 to 75 mm, overlying soft clay subgrades. Series of tests were conducted in a steel test tank of dimensions $700mm{\times}300mm{\times}700mm$. In addition to the laboratory model tests, numerical simulations were performed using a finite difference code to predict the behavior of geocell reinforced ballast. The results from numerical simulations were compared with the experimental data. The numerical and experimental results manifested the importance that the geocell reinforcement has a significant effect on the ballast behaviour. The results depicted that the stiffness of underlying soft clay subgrade has a significant influence on the behavior of the geocell-aggregate composite material in redistributing the loading system.

        Expiration-Day Effects on Index Futures: Evidence from Indian Market

        Ravi Kumar SAMINENI,Raja Babu PUPPALA,Ramesh MUTHANGI,Syamsundar KULAPATHI 한국유통과학회 2020 The Journal of Asian Finance, Economics and Busine Vol.7 No.11

        Nifty Bank Index has started trading in futures and options (F&O) segment from 13th June 2005 in National Stock Exchange. The purpose of the study is to enhance the literature by examining expiration effect on the price volatility and price reversal of Underlying Index in India. Historical data used for the current study primarily comprise of daily close prices of Nifty Bank which is the only equity sectoral index in India which is traded in derivatives market and its Future contract value is derived from the underlying CNX Bank Index during the period 1st January 2010 till 31st March 2020. To check stationarity of the data, Augmented Dicky Fuller test was used. The study employed ARMA- EGARCH model for analysing the data. The empirical results revealed that there is no effect on the mean returns of underlying Index and EGARCH (1,1) model furthermore shows there is existence of leverage effect in the Bank Index i.e., negative shocks causes more fluctuations in the Index than positive news of similar magnitude. The outcome of the study specifies that there is no effect on volatility on the underlying sectoral index due to expiration days and also observed no price reversal effect once the expiration days are over.

        Evaluation of Geotechnical Parameters of a Lagoonal Clay Deposit in Jiangsu Lixia River Area of China by Seismic Piezocone Tests

        Guojun Cai,Songyu Liu,Anand J. Puppala 대한토목학회 2016 KSCE JOURNAL OF CIVIL ENGINEERING Vol.20 No.5

        The use of the Seismic Piezocone Test (SCPTU) in geotechnical site investigation offers field assessment on stratigraphy and soil behavior. Compared with some traditional investigation methods such as drilling, sampling and field inspecting method or laboratory test procedures, SCPTU can greatly accelerate the field work and hereby reduce corresponding operation cost. The results of a site investigation on the soft, normally to slightly overconsolidated, Lixia River lagoonal clay deposit underlying several expressway lines, including a seismic piezocone penetration test, undisturbed sampling from an adjacent borehole, and laboratory testing, are reported. The determination of soil profile and the main geotechnical properties is facilitated by the use of seismic piezocone penetration test that can provide up to four independent reading with depth from a single sounding. The coupled use of normalized cone resistance and pore pressure parameter provides a simple and quick soil classification for highly interbedding of Lixia River lagoon ground. Comparison of the results reveals the validity of SCPTU tests to interpret the engineering properties of Lixia River lagoonal clay. These data will also be particularly useful for future local construction work.

        A Study on Unfolding Asymmetric Volatility: A Case Study of National Stock Exchange in India

        Ravi Kumar SAMINENI,Raja Babu PUPPALA,Syamsundar KULAPATHI,Shiva Kumar MADAPATHI 한국유통과학회 2021 The Journal of Asian Finance, Economics and Busine Vol.8 No.4

        The study aims to find the asymmetric effect in National Stock Exchange in which the Nifty50 is considered as proxy for NSE. A return can be stated as the change in value of a security over a certain time period. Volatility is the rate of change in security value. It is an arithmetical assessment of the dispersion of yields of security prices. Stock prices are extremely unpredictable and make the investment in equities risky. Predicting volatility and modeling are the most profuse areas to explore. The current study describes the association between two variables, namely, stock yields and volatility in equity market in India. The volatility is measured by employing asymmetric GARCH technique, i.e., the EGARCH (1,1) tool, which was used in building the study. The closing prices of Nifty on day-to-day basis were used for analysis from the period 2011 to 2020 with 2,478 observations in the study. The model arrests the lopsided volatility during the mentioned period. The outcome of asymmetric GARCH model revealed the subsistence of leverage effect in the index and confirms the impact of conditional variance as well. Furthermore, the EGARCH technique was evidenced to be apt in seizure of unsymmetrical volatility.

      • Chemopreventive Effects of Korean Angelica versus Its Major Pyranocoumarins on Two Lineages of Transgenic Adenocarcinoma of Mouse Prostate Carcinogenesis

        Tang, Su-Ni,Zhang, Jinhui,Wu, Wei,Jiang, Peixin,Puppala, Manohar,Zhang, Yong,Xing, Chengguo,Kim, Sung-Hoon,Jiang, Cheng,,, Junxuan American Association for Cancer Research 2015 CANCER PREVENTION RESEARCH Vol.8 No.9

        <P>We showed previously that daily gavage of <I>Angelica gigas</I> Nakai (AGN) root ethanolic extract starting 8 weeks of age inhibited growth of prostate epithelium and neuroendocrine carcinomas (NE-Ca) in the transgenic adenocarcinoma of mouse prostate (TRAMP) model. Because decursin (D) and its isomer decursinol angelate (DA) are major pyranocoumarins in AGN extract, we tested the hypothesis that D/DA represented active/prodrug compounds against TRAMP carcinogenesis. Three groups of male C57BL/6 TRAMP mice were gavage treated daily with excipient vehicle, AGN (5 mg per mouse), or equimolar D/DA (3 mg per mouse) from 8 weeks to 16 or 28 weeks of age. Measurement of plasma and NE-Ca D, DA, and their common metabolite decursinol indicated similar retention from AGN versus D/DA dosing. The growth of TRAMP dorsolateral prostate (DLP) in AGN- and D/DA-treated mice was inhibited by 66% and 61% at 16 weeks and by 67% and 72% at 28 weeks, respectively. Survival of mice bearing NE-Ca to 28 weeks was improved by AGN, but not by D/DA. Nevertheless, AGN- and D/DA-treated mice had lower NE-Ca burden. Immunohistochemical and mRNA analyses of DLP showed that AGN and D/DA exerted similar inhibition of TRAMP epithelial lesion progression and key cell-cycle genes. Profiling of NE-Ca mRNA showed a greater scope of modulating angiogenesis, epithelial–mesenchymal transition, invasion–metastasis, and inflammation genes by AGN than D/DA. The data therefore support D/DA as probable active/prodrug compounds against TRAMP epithelial lesions, and they cooperate with non-pyranocoumarin compounds to fully express AGN efficacy against NE-Ca. <I>Cancer Prev Res; 8(9); 835–44. ©2015 AACR</I>.</P>

        Characterization of Spatial Variability of CPTU Data in a Liquefaction Site Improved by Vibro-compaction Method

        Guojun Cai,Jun Lin,Songyu Liu,Anand J. Puppala 대한토목학회 2017 KSCE JOURNAL OF CIVIL ENGINEERING Vol.21 No.1

        Vibro-compaction is a ground improvement technique in which the weak or loose soil deposits are compacted by the vibrating probe or vibroflot penetration. The Piezocone Penetration Test (CPTU) has been found to be one of the best methods to assess the effect of ground improvement due to its continuous, reliable and repeatable data collected. The spatial variability of a liquefactionsusceptible site improved by vibro-compaction was assessed using random field theory. The CPTU soundings were conducted to characterize the variation of random field model parameters. Given the relatively high data frequency of the cone tip resistance in vertical direction, the vertical random field parameters are determined with the modified Bartlett random field estimation procedure. Due to the lack of data in horizontal direction, the horizontal random field parameters are evaluated using a less rigorous way of the autocorrelation. It is shown that the normalized cone resistance is a well estimator of spatial variability. The statistical results suggest that both Scale of Fluctuation (SOF) and the Coefficient of Variation (COV) varied in different way after vibro-compaction.

        Engineering Properties and Microstructural Characteristics of Foundation Silt Stabilized By Lignin-based Industrial By-product

        Tao Zhang,Guojun Cai,Songyu Liu,Anand J. Puppala 대한토목학회 2016 KSCE JOURNAL OF CIVIL ENGINEERING Vol.20 No.7

        This paper presents details of a study that deals with determination of engineering properties and microstructural characteristics of a foundation soil (silt) sedimented in Jiangsu Province of China when it is stabilized by lignin-based industrial by-product. A series of laboratory tests were carried out with respect to evaluate the effect of lignin content and curing time on the overall soil properties including Atterberg limits, pH, unconfined compressive strength, stress-strain characteristics, secant modulus, and California bearing ratio. In addition, scanning electron microscopy, X-ray diffraction, and mercury intrusion porosimetry studies were conducted to understand the microstructural characteristics and stabilization mechanism of the stabilized silt. The results reveal that lignin has a great potential to improve engineering properties of silt and shows a promising prospect as a new environmentally friendly soil stabilizer. Curing time and lignin content have significant influence on the basic engineering properties and microstructural characteristics of the lignin stabilized silt. The optimum content of lignin for foundation silt in Jiangsu Province of China is approximately 12%. The precipitated cementing material is formed after stabilization of lignin with a period of curing. The stabilized silt switches over its response from a brittle to ductile material in the presence of lignin. Peak analysis results of the pore-size distribution curves demonstrates that the lignin stabilized silt exhibits bimodal behavior when the lignin content less than 8%, whereas it displays unimodal type when the lignin content is more than or equal to 8%. These observations provide enhanced understanding of lignin-based industrial by-product as a soil stabilizer at the foundation construction.
